What is Ubuntu system requirements?

What is Ubuntu system requirements?

The recommended system requirements are: CPU: 1 gigahertz or better. RAM: 1 gigabyte or more. Disk: a minimum of 2.5 gigabytes.

Is Ubuntu 16.04 LTS still supported?

Is Ubuntu 16.04 LTS still supported? Yes, Ubuntu 16.04 LTS is supported until 2026 through Canonical’s Extended Security Maintenance (ESM) product.

What does Ubuntu EOL mean?

end of life
The end of life of a software means the software has reached the end of its predefined support period. Beyond this date, the software won’t get any feature, maintenance or security updates. You may continue using the software past its end of life date but at your own risk.

Is Ubuntu Server 32-bit?

Canonical decided to drop support for 32-bit computers, so they stopped releasing 32-bit ISOs since Ubuntu 18.04. …
